Subtract 21/10 from 40/9
1st number: 4 4/9, 2nd number: 2 1/10
40/9 - 21/10 is 211/90.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 9 and 10 is 90
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 90 - For the 1st fraction, since 9 × 10 = 90,
40/9 = 40 × 10/9 × 10 = 400/90 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 10 × 9 = 90,
21/10 = 21 × 9/10 × 9 = 189/90 - Subtract the two like fractions:
